Ref - pain in my hips.

The notable point of my week last was going to my primary care physician ($20 co-pay) for him to refer me to an Orthopedic Specialist ($50 co-pay). I was then directed over to the X-Ray unit, where they took pictures.

The Specialist looked at the X-Rays and after an examination, suspects I do not have a worn out hip(s) problem - but that I have spinal stenosis. So, I get referred over to an MRI unit that has to check with my insurance (Medicare) to see if they will cover an MRI.

Meanwhile, in spite of the aspirin, acetaminophen, concoction of grape juice and fruit pectin, internet store bought stuff called ActiveMotion and multiple doses of *** oil - my ass still fucking hurts!

So if I do have spinal stenosis, a shot of cortizone may offer temporary relief. However, for long term relief, surgery may be in order.

What caused this condition - OLD AGE!
